- Abstract: Ca 2+, a ubiquitous but nuanced modulator of cellular physiology, is meticulously controlled intracellularly. However, intracellular Ca 2+ regulation, such as mitochondrial Ca 2+ buffering capacity, can be disrupted by 1 O2 . Thus, the intracellular Ca 2+ overload, which is recognized as one of the important cell pro‐death factors, can be logically achieved by the synergism of 1 O2 with exogenous Ca 2+ delivery. Reported herein is a nanoscale covalent organic framework (NCOF)‐based nanoagent, namely CaCO3 @COF‐BODIPY‐2I@GAG (4 ), which is embedded with CaCO3 nanoparticle (NP) and surface‐decorated with BODIPY‐2I as photosensitizer (PS) and glycosaminoglycan (GAG) targeting agent for CD44 receptors on digestive tract tumor cells. Under illumination, the light‐triggered 1 O2 not only kills the tumor cells directly, but also leads to their mitochondrial dysfunction and Ca 2+ overload. An enhanced antitumor efficiency is achieved via photodynamic therapy (PDT) and Ca 2+ overload synergistic therapy.
